Trump also announced that reciprocal tariffs would be applied to all countries that impose import taxes on American goods throughout the week, but he did not specify which countries would be targeted or whether there would be any exemptions.

On Sunday, while traveling from Mar-a-Lago resort in Florida to the Super Bowl in New Orleans, Trump told reporters about his plans: "If they impose tariffs on us, we will impose tariffs on them."

Canada and Mexico are two of the United States' largest steel trade partners, with Canada being the largest supplier of aluminum to the U.S.

Trump's remarks also led to a decline in the shares of major South Korean steel and automobile manufacturers. South Korea is a major steel exporter to the United States.

Shares of steel company POSCO fell by 3.6%, while Hyundai Steel shares dropped by 2.9%.

Shares of automaker Kia Corp also fell by 3.6% in early morning trading.

Trump’s move signals another major escalation in his trade policy, which has already led to retaliatory measures from China.

Earlier this month, Trump threatened to impose a 25% import tariff on Canadian and Mexican products, but later postponed the plan for 30 days after meeting with the leaders of both countries.

He also imposed a new 10% tariff on all Chinese goods entering the U.S. In response, Beijing enacted its own tariffs, which took effect on Monday.

Trump also announced that he would unveil more retaliatory tariffs "on Tuesday or Wednesday," which would take effect "immediately" after the announcement.

"We will impose reciprocal tariffs on those who take advantage of the United States. It will be great for everyone, including other countries," Trump stated.
